Stove-Top Greek Lemon Potatoes
These flavorful Greek lemon potatoes are a delightful side dish, combining the brightness of lemon with the richness of olive oil and herbs. Perfect for accompanying any meal.
-
2
pounds
small new potatoes
-
3
tablespoons
extra virgin Greek olive oil
-
1
tablespoon
butter
-
1/2
cup
dry white wine
-
Juice of 1 large lemon
-
Greek sea salt to taste
-
2
tablespoons
fresh rosemary leaves or 2 teaspoons dried
-
2
teaspoons
dried Greek wild thyme or oregano
-
Place potatoes in a saucepan with olive oil, butter, wine, lemon juice, and salt. Bring to a boil, then cover and cook over high heat for 8 minutes.
-
Reduce heat and continue cooking for about 20 minutes to brown the potatoes.
-
Add herbs and cook for a few more minutes, stirring occasionally. Remove and serve
